Understanding Page Count Calculations

A 5,000-word assignment is a substantial academic undertaking, typical of a senior capstone project or a master's seminar paper. Visualizing the final page count helps you structure your outline and allocate sufficient time for research. The universal academic baseline is that one double-spaced page holds about 250 words, while a single-spaced page packs in about 500 words.

5000 Word Research Paper: Double-Spaced Format

If you are writing for high school or university, double-spacing is mandatory. It provides necessary white space for professors to write corrections. Following MLA, APA, or Chicago guidelines (12pt font, 1-inch margins), a 5,000-word paper spans precisely 20 pages. Note that this 20-page count is exclusively for the text—your title page and bibliography will add extra pages.

5000 Word Research Paper: Single-Spaced Format

Single spacing is rarely used in academia but is the standard for white papers, corporate research reports, and journal article drafts. Without the spacing gaps, your text density doubles. Therefore, a single-spaced 5,000-word document will take up about 10 full pages.

Factors That Affect Page Count

While the 20-page benchmark is highly reliable, specific formatting choices can compress or stretch your document:

  • Font Type: Times New Roman is narrow. Wider fonts like Arial, Courier New, or Verdana consume more horizontal space, potentially pushing a 5,000-word paper to 21 or 22 pages.
  • Font Size: Academic standards dictate 12-point font. Using 11-point font to save paper (or 13-point font to cheat the limit) alters the page count dramatically.
  • Margins: Standard 1-inch margins yield 20 pages. If a specific journal requests 1.5-inch margins, the writable area shrinks, extending the paper to 24+ pages.
  • Line Spacing: Occasionally, institutions request 1.5 line spacing. In this format, 5,000 words will equal roughly 15 pages.
  • Header/Footer Space: Large multi-line headers on every page reduce the space available for body text, marginally inflating the final page count.

5000 Word Research Paper by Font Type

Typography impacts character tracking. If you draft 5,000 words in 12pt Calibri (the Microsoft default), it might compress to 19 pages because the font is highly compact. If you draft the same text in 12pt Arial, it will comfortably spill over onto page 21.

5000 Word Research Paper by Margin Size

Changing your margins from 1 inch to 1.25 inches (a common older standard) squeezes the text block. A double-spaced 5,000-word paper with 1.25-inch margins will extend to approximately 23 pages.

How to Calculate Page Count

Use these simple mathematical formulas to estimate any academic assignment:

  • Double-Spaced: Word Count ÷ 250 = Pages (e.g., 5,000 ÷ 250 = 20 pages)
  • Single-Spaced: Word Count ÷ 500 = Pages (e.g., 5,000 ÷ 500 = 10 pages)
  • 1.5 Spaced: Word Count ÷ 333 = Pages (e.g., 5,000 ÷ 333 ≈ 15 pages)

Tips for Writing 5000 Word Research Papers

Writing 20 pages requires architectural planning. You cannot "wing" a 5,000-word paper. Break the word count into sections: allocate 500 words for the introduction, 1,500 words for the literature review, 1,000 for methodology, 1,500 for discussion/results, and 500 for the conclusion. This micro-goal approach prevents the 20-page requirement from feeling paralyzing.

Time Management for 5000 Word Papers

Do not attempt to write 5,000 words the night before. An average student types roughly 1,000 words an hour, but academic writing requires constant pauses for citation formatting and referencing. Expect the physical writing process to take 8 to 12 hours, spread across several days, completely separate from the time required to conduct the actual research.

How many paragraphs are in a 5000-word paper?

Assuming an average paragraph length of 100 to 150 words, a 5,000-word paper contains roughly 35 to 50 paragraphs.

Is a 5000-word paper considered a thesis?

A 5,000-word paper is common for an undergraduate senior thesis or capstone project, but it is generally too short for a master's level thesis, which usually starts around 10,000 words.

How many references should I have for 5000 words?

A standard academic rule is 1.5 to 2 sources per page. For a 20-page (5,000-word) paper, aim for 30 to 40 highly credible academic sources.

How long should the introduction be for a 5000-word paper?

The introduction should make up roughly 10% of the total length, so aim for an introduction of 400 to 500 words (about 2 double-spaced pages).
